Office space from $19635
POA
Office space from $9799
Serviced offices from $299
Office space from $500
POA
POA
Serviced offices from $900
POA
POA
Serviced offices from $900
POA
Serviced offices from $300
Office space from $45557
POA
Serviced offices from $910
POA
POA
Office space from $850
Serviced offices from $34510
POA
POA
POA
Items per page